The SSA said that if people suspect they have been incorrectly declared dead, they need to head to their local Social Security office as soon as possible. The agency provides a list of documentation the person needs to bring, noting that only one piece of identification is needed.
HOW DO SUCH HORRIBLE MISTAKES HAPPEN? For you to be declared deceased, it just takes a wrong sequence of numbers to be entered in the list. For instance, when a person dies, his death certificate is given to the SSA to update his account information as deceased.
We collect death information to administer our programs. We receive death reports from many sources, including family members, funeral homes, financial institutions, postal authorities, States and other Federal agencies. It is important to note our records are not a comprehensive record of all deaths in the country.

To date, 453.7 million different numbers have been issued. Q20: Are Social Security numbers reused after a person dies? A: No. We do not reassign a Social Security number (SSN) after the number holder's death.
